예제 #1
0
        public TitleViewPage(EvasObject parent, System.Maui.Page page, View titleView) : base(parent)
        {
            _page      = Platform.GetOrCreateRenderer(page).NativeView as Native.Page;
            _titleView = titleView;
            if (_titleView != null)
            {
                var renderer = Platform.GetOrCreateRenderer(_titleView);
                (renderer as LayoutRenderer)?.RegisterOnLayoutUpdated();

                this.PackEnd(renderer.NativeView);
            }
            this.PackEnd(_page);
            this.LayoutUpdated += OnLayoutUpdated;
        }
예제 #2
0
 public NavigationChildPage(System.Maui.Page page)
 {
     Page       = page;
     Identifier = Guid.NewGuid().ToString();
 }
예제 #3
0
 public PageContainer(System.Maui.Page element, int index)
 {
     Page  = element;
     Index = index;
 }
예제 #4
0
파일: Carousel.cs 프로젝트: zmtzawqlp/maui
 public CarouselPage(Container gtkPage, System.Maui.Page page)
 {
     GtkPage = gtkPage;
     Page    = page;
 }